fbpx

Lavora con noi

Sei il titolare di una web agency o di un’agenzia di comunicazione?

Vuoi valutare se ci sono le condizioni per poter lavorare insieme su uno o più progetti?

Allora puoi telefonare gratuitamente il numero verde >> 800 66 25 81 << ti risponderà direttamente un nostro manager.

Sei uno sviluppatore?

Lo sapevi che essere piccoli può essere un vantaggio?

Lo sviluppatore vuole sviluppare. Punto.

Non ha voglia di perdere giorni interi ad affrontare infiniti livelli di burocrazia o sentirsi come una piccolissima vite di una macchina enorme.

Ristrutturazione Software è grande abbastanza da risolvere problemi software secondo i più moderni standard di lavoro e allo stesso tempo combattere la burocrazia.

Siamo organizzati per poter dare ad ogni singolo sviluppatore l’opportunità di fare la differenza ed avere un impatto grande e duraturo.

Che cosa ti motiva realmente?

Quasi sicuramente desideri vedere il tuo codice in azione su software che hanno un impatto reale sulla vita delle persone.

Magari sei d’accordo sul fatto che sviluppare un bottoncino che sarà usato da un ragazzino di 12 anni per mettere like ad una foto di un gatto è completamente diverso dallo sviluppare un sistema di prenotazioni che consente ad una azienda turistica di far viaggiare milioni di famiglie in tutto il mondo.

Grazie al tuo contributo, grazie al tuo codice!

Probabilmente questo lavoro non salverà la vita a migliaia di persone, ma non ci sono dubbi sull’impatto reale e profondo che ha nella società e su noi stessi come professionisti.

Ti voglio rassicurare su un aspetto. Apprezziamo gli errori!

La nostra esperienza ci ha insegnato che chi fa sbaglia.

L'unico modo per non sbagliare è non fare niente sia nel lavoro che nella vita, ed a noi con queste persone non piace lavorare e non ci lavoriamo.

Pertanto gli errori li consideriamo semplicemente come occasioni per imparare la lezione e crescere insieme, come professionisti e come persone. D’altronde perché cadiamo?

Per imparare a rimetterci in piedi.

Adesso ti chiedo gentilmente di prestare la massima attenzione. Consulta bene le indicazioni sul tipo di profilo che ricerchiamo. Dopo aver letto attentamente, se ti vuoi candidare, scrivici con la massima serenità.

Backend Developer

Tech Skills
  • Laurea in informatica (breve o specialistica)
  • Età compresa tra 23 – 29 anni
  • Buona conoscenza della lingua Inglese (leggere, scrivere, ascoltare)
  • PHP Object Oriented
  • Design Pattern
  • Esperienza nell'utilizzo di Composer
  • Sviluppo e pubblicazione di package PHP
  • Sei in grado di sviluppare piccole applicazioni MVC anche senza l’uso di framework
  • Sai sviluppare test del codice con PHPunit
  • Sviluppo di sistemi RESTful
  • Conoscenza del protocollo HTTP e del formato di scambio dati JSON
  • Ottima conoscenza dello standard di autenticazione OAuth2
  • Progettazione di basi di dati relazionali
  • Database MySQL
  • Git e Git flow per il versioning del codice
Preferenziali
  • Buona conoscenza del Framework Laravel

Frontend Developer

Tech Skills
  • Laurea in informatica (breve o specialistica)
  • Età compresa tra 23 – 29 anni
  • Buona conoscenza della lingua Inglese (leggere, scrivere, ascoltare)
  • SPA (Single Page Application)
  • Design di componenti
  • Esperienza nell’utilizzo di servizi REST
  • Autenticazione OAuth2
  • Conoscenza del protocollo HTTP e del formato di scambio dati JSON
  • Javascript ES6 
  • Buona conoscenza del framework VueJs
  • Sviluppo in nodeJs
  • Sviluppo di moduli npm
  • Bootstrap CSS framework
  • Design di interfacce utente
  • Sviluppo di UI HTML+CSS da psd
  • Git e Git flow per il versioning del codice

Full Stack Developer

Tech Skills
  • Laurea in informatica (breve o specialistica)
  • Età compresa tra 23 – 29 anni
  • Buona conoscenza della lingua Inglese (leggere, scrivere, ascoltare)
  • PHP Object Oriented
  • Composer per l'utilizzo di package php
  • Sei in grado di sviluppare delle piccole applicazioni MVC anche senza l’uso di framework
  • Esperienza nell’utilizzo di servizi REST
  • Conoscenza del protocollo HTTP e del formato di scambio dati JSON
  • Database MySQL
  • Bootstrap CSS framework
  • Javascript ES6 
  • JQuery
  • Git e Git flow per il versioning del codice
Preferenziali
  • VueJs (anche conoscenza base)
  • Framework PHP Laravel

Soft Skills

E’ necessaria la piena consapevolezza di quanto sia importante far parte di un team di lavoro competente con voglia di crescere e migliorare insieme. Sai che da solo/a puoi essere veloce nel breve termine ma per andare lontano serve un team affidabile e tanta formazione.

Ami l'ordine

Non ti accontenti del “Basta che funzioni”. Ti piace mantenere ordine nel codice che scrivi, prediligi la leggibilità alla brevità: indentatura e commenti non li dimentichi mai e cerchi sempre il Don’t Repeat Yourself.

Ti piace aiutare gli altri

Ti senti a tuo agio condividendo le tue conoscenze con il resto del Team e renderti utile per aiutare il Cliente, propositivo/a, tech-oriented, affidabile. Non consideri che la vita del tuo software sia un problema di qualcun altro.

Ti piace imparare cose nuove

Passione per le migliori pratiche di design e coding e il desiderio di sviluppare nuove idee. Sai già che gli errori sono delle opportunità per imparare. Pensi in modo critico e sei felice di essere smentito/a. Sei metodico/a nella risoluzione dei problemi e nel debug. Quando ti trovi bloccato/a, fai un passo indietro e ri-analizzi. Sei in grado di respingere la pressione e prenderti lo spazio necessario per pensare.

Sei puntuale

Se c’è una scadenza da rispettare, sei il/la primo/a a terminare il lavoro perché non ti piace far aspettare.

Responsabilità

Acquisire una approfondita conoscenza dei sistemi che sviluppi. Contribuire alla pianificazione ed al miglioramento. Individuare problemi di integrità e manutenibilità del software. Studiare e proporre le soluzioni.

Sviluppare codice secondo i principi SOLID. Fare code-review in modo costruttivo favorendo lo sviluppo di nuove competenze dove possibile.

Contribuire alle discussioni in modo razionale, civile e competente quando sorgono controversie tecniche.

Tenere il passo con lo sviluppo delle tecnologie del settore e la loro rilevanza per l’azienda. Condividi in modo aperto e continuo le tue conoscenze.

Devi sapere una cosa.

Ristrutturazione Software ha l’ambizione di creare un team di persone appassionate di tecnologia che credono nella nostra missione:

“portare professionalità e trasparenza nello sviluppo software in Cloud attraverso esperienze magiche per i clienti che usano i nostri software.”

Pertanto ti garantiamo

  • Sviluppo tecnologico allo stato dell’arte
  • Serietà e puntualità nei pagamenti
  • Grandi opportunità di apprendimento
  • Esperienza
  • Reattività e massima apertura a nuove idee
  • Il giusto mix tra Smart Work in remoto e lavoro in sede evitando di sprecare ore e ore tutti i giorni imbottigliato nel traffico

Adesso se pensi di essere il candidato ideale clicca sul link qui sotto per compilare il breve questionario ed inoltrare la tua candidatura

Spero di conoscerti e di lavorare insieme a te.

GRATIS - La guida che ha aiutato aziende a NON buttare dai 20 ai 100.000€ nello sviluppo di software aziendali